Abstract: The present disclosure relates to system information transmission methods and apparatus. One example method includes receiving, by a first network node, at least one type of system information (SI) from a second network node, where the at least one type of SI includes first SI, receiving, by the first network node, a request message from a terminal device, where the request message is used to request the first SI, and sending, by the first network node, the first SI to the terminal device based on the request message and the at least one type of SI.

Abstract: Example methods for processing a system message and network devices are described herein. One example method includes obtaining, by a user terminal, indication information, wherein the indication information indicates that a system message of a cell cluster has changed or whether a system message of a cell cluster has changed, wherein the cell cluster comprises a set of at least one cell. The user terminal can then determine whether currently used information about the cell cluster needs to be updated. In some instances, obtaining the indication information comprises obtaining a system information update message. In those instances, determining whether currently used information about the cell cluster needs to be updated can include updating the currently used information about the cell cluster or updating a system message of a cell in the currently used cell cluster based on the indication information in the system information update message.

Abstract: A method includes: sending, by a first network device, a first configuration message to a terminal device, where the first configuration message is used to instruct the terminal device to configure a second ciphering/deciphering function associated with a second network device and share a first data packet numbering/reordering function, and the terminal device is configured with the first data packet numbering/reordering function and a first ciphering/deciphering function associated with the first network device; and receiving, by the first network device, a first configuration complete message sent by the terminal device. In this embodiment, the first configuration message is used so that the terminal device may configure the function associated with the second network device. Therefore, during handover, the terminal device may simultaneously perform data transmission with the second network device and the first network device, to reduce or avoid a service interruption time caused by handover.

Abstract: Embodiments of the present invention provide a method for random access in an idle state and a device. The method includes: sending, by user equipment (UE), a random access preamble to a evolved NodeB (eNB), and receiving a random access response message that is sent by the eNB according to the random access preamble; sending, by the UE, a first message to the eNB according to first uplink grant information; and receiving, by the UE, second uplink grant information sent by the eNB, and sending to-be-sent data to the eNB according to the second uplink grant information. According to the method for random access in an idle state and the device provided in the embodiments of the present invention, accuracy of uplink resource allocation is improved during random access of UE in an idle state.

Abstract: Embodiments of the present disclosure provide a multicast service transmission method, including: a terminal receives from a first cell, configuration information corresponding to an MBMS, where the configuration information corresponding to the MBMS includes: a cell identity of at least one second cell; the terminal obtains configuration information of the second cell based on the cell identity of the second cell; and receives from the second cell, an MTCH based on the configuration information of the second cell. This resolves a problem that the terminal can receive in one cell, an MCCH and the MTCH corresponding to the MBMS, and achieves an effect that the terminal device can receive, from the first cell and the at least one second cell, a same multicast service by using a carrier aggregation technology.

Abstract: This application provides a measurement method, a terminal device, and an access network device. The measurement method includes: measuring, by a terminal device, signal quality of a plurality of beams, where the signal quality of the plurality of beams is obtained by using synchronization signal blocks; the signal quality of the plurality of beams includes signal quality of a same beam at different moments, and the plurality of beams belong to one cell; and obtaining, by the terminal device, signal quality of the cell based on the signal quality of the plurality of beams. In this way, cell measurement based on a synchronization signal is implemented, and the signal quality of the cell obtained based on the signal quality of the plurality of beams at the different moments is more accurate.

Abstract: A communication device receives a parallel hybrid automatic repeat request (HARQ) communication instruction, where the parallel HARQ communication instruction is used to instruct the communication device to send or receive data in a parallel HARQ manner, where the sending data in a parallel HARQ manner by the communication device is sending, by the communication device, at least one data packet with same content within a transmission time interval; and the receiving data in a parallel HARQ manner by the communication device is receiving at least one data packet with same content within a transmission time interval, and performing combined decoding on the received at least one data packet with same content; and the communication device sends or receives the data in the parallel HARQ manner according to the parallel HARQ communication instruction. According to the present invention, a delay of data transmission can be reduced.

Abstract: A method includes when a triggering instruction for triggering a periodic (buffer status report) BSR is received, obtaining a priority of a logical channel to which uplink data that is being sent belongs, and obtaining a priority of a logical channel to which the periodic BSR belongs, determining whether a priority of the uplink data is higher than a priority of the periodic BSR, and sending the uplink data to a base station at a priority higher than the priority of the periodic BSR when the priority of the uplink data is higher than the priority of the periodic BSR, or sending the periodic BSR to a base station at a priority higher than the priority of the uplink data when the priority of the uplink data is lower than the priority of the periodic BSR.
